觸摸屏工控一體機(jī)是一種集成了計(jì)算機(jī)、觸摸屏、輸入輸出接口的一個(gè)系統(tǒng)設(shè)備。在工業(yè)控制領(lǐng)域,工控一體機(jī)應(yīng)用越來越普遍,已經(jīng)成為工業(yè)控制行業(yè)中不可或缺的一部分。而編寫觸摸屏工控一體機(jī)的程序則是其中至關(guān)重要的一環(huán),是實(shí)現(xiàn)最佳結(jié)果的關(guān)鍵所在。
本文將圍繞著觸摸屏工控一體機(jī)編程,深入討論如何實(shí)現(xiàn)最佳結(jié)果,在這方面,我們將會(huì)從以下幾個(gè)方面進(jìn)行探討:
一、了解工控一體機(jī)硬件原理
了解工控一體機(jī)的硬件原理是切入編程的前提,不同的硬件平臺(tái)在編寫應(yīng)用程序時(shí),我們需要考慮到處理器、存儲(chǔ)器、硬盤、外設(shè)接口等參數(shù),這些硬件參數(shù)極大影響了我們?cè)趹?yīng)用程序開發(fā)中所需要考慮到的方面,需要根據(jù)實(shí)際情況進(jìn)行調(diào)整。因此在進(jìn)行編程之前,我們需要了解工控一體機(jī)硬件的概念,以便進(jìn)行合理的編寫。
二、了解工控一體機(jī)操作系統(tǒng)
工控一體機(jī)的操作系統(tǒng)和普通PC機(jī)不同,在進(jìn)行編程時(shí)應(yīng)注意其特殊性。操作系統(tǒng)的選擇對(duì)程序的編寫有著極為重要影響,應(yīng)該根據(jù)實(shí)際需求和性能來進(jìn)行選擇。
三、掌握工控一體機(jī)編程語言
對(duì)于工控一體機(jī)編程,我們可以采用更加高效和實(shí)用的方式,如C、C++、VB、Python等編程語言進(jìn)行開發(fā)。當(dāng)然,不同的編程語言也有著不同的優(yōu)缺點(diǎn),應(yīng)選擇適合自己的編程語言進(jìn)行編寫。
四、了解工控一體機(jī)應(yīng)用開發(fā)方法
在工控一體機(jī)應(yīng)用開發(fā)中,我們應(yīng)該采用可靠的方法來進(jìn)行開發(fā),在編碼過程中有一些常見的開發(fā)技術(shù),如面向?qū)ο缶幊?、多任?wù)編程、設(shè)計(jì)模式等,通過掌握這些技術(shù),我們可以提高程序的性能。
五、加強(qiáng)應(yīng)用程序測(cè)試
應(yīng)用程序測(cè)試是保障程序安全有效的機(jī)制,加強(qiáng)測(cè)試可以確保程序工作正常,這對(duì)于工業(yè)控制上的應(yīng)用程序而言,是極為關(guān)鍵的??梢赃m當(dāng)使用一些測(cè)試工具進(jìn)行測(cè)試,如Rigol、RedBuild、TestComplete等測(cè)試工具。
六、開發(fā)完善的文檔
我們應(yīng)該開發(fā)完善的文檔記錄,滿足用戶管理、文檔升級(jí)等需要。適當(dāng)?shù)奈臋n生成可以幫助用戶更好的操作和開發(fā),對(duì)應(yīng)用程序的完善非常有幫助,可以避免重復(fù)開發(fā),提高開發(fā)效率。
七、應(yīng)用程序升級(jí)
應(yīng)用程序升級(jí)可以幫助增強(qiáng)程序的功能和性能,增加軟件的兼容性和可拓展性。應(yīng)用程序的升級(jí)要考慮與原有的系統(tǒng)集成度以及上述六個(gè)方面,進(jìn)行升級(jí)前一定要測(cè)試和最后一個(gè)步驟。
在實(shí)現(xiàn)最佳結(jié)果的過程中,我們需要注意幾個(gè)方面,只有以這些方面為出發(fā)點(diǎn),才能避免不必要的問題和錯(cuò)誤,才能在開發(fā)過程中發(fā)揮我們的編程實(shí)力和能力,進(jìn)而實(shí)現(xiàn)條件優(yōu)越、功能強(qiáng)大、性能穩(wěn)定、界面簡(jiǎn)潔的工控一體機(jī)應(yīng)用程序。
總之,深入了解如何實(shí)現(xiàn)最佳結(jié)果,是一個(gè)不斷學(xué)習(xí)和提高的過程。希望在日后的工控一體機(jī)編程中,能夠不斷發(fā)掘創(chuàng)造性編程思路,實(shí)現(xiàn)自己想要的獨(dú)特效果。